Who is uninsured in the IE

• As of 2003-lastest stats• 17% of the IE’s non-elderly population does

not have health care coverage• The majority of these adults are employed but

not offer job-based insurance, earn low wages and work for small companies

Lack of Health care and poverty has led to

• San Bernardino County • Fourth most obese area in United States• Third highest heart disease rate in state• 71% of school children do not meet fitness

standards• Worst healthy food access in state, with six times

as many unhealthy food retail outlets as healthy• Two-thirds of adults not meeting recommended

physical activity levels
